From a0c9a19ba42d0bdf26dcd910cf975d4bf51a0d48 Mon Sep 17 00:00:00 2001 From: Jakub Kicinski Date: Thu, 11 Apr 2024 19:14:21 +0800 Subject: [PATCH] net/sched: act_mirred: use the backlog for mirred ingress mainline inclusion from mainline-v6.8-rc6 commit 52f671db18823089a02f07efc04efdb2272ddc17 category: bugfix bugzilla: https://gitee.com/src-openeuler/kernel/issues/I9E2LT CVE: CVE-2024-26740 Reference: https://git.kernel.org/pub/scm/linux/kernel/git/torvalds/linux.git/commit/?id=52f671db18823089a02f07efc04efdb2272ddc17 -------------------------------- The test Davide added in commit ca22da2fbd69 ("act_mirred: use the backlog for nested calls to mirred ingress") hangs our testing VMs every 10 or so runs, with the familiar tcp_v4_rcv -> tcp_v4_rcv deadlock reported by lockdep. The problem as previously described by Davide (see Link) is that if we reverse flow of traffic with the redirect (egress -> ingress) we may reach the same socket which generated the packet. And we may still be holding its socket lock. The common solution to such deadlocks is to put the packet in the Rx backlog, rather than run the Rx path inline. Do that for all egress -> ingress reversals, not just once we started to nest mirred calls. In the past there was a concern that the backlog indirection will lead to loss of error reporting / less accurate stats. But the current workaround does not seem to address the issue.
